Coding Unicorn Shield Projects

Find more Information on Kickstarter (coming soon)!

In this repository we will keep a list of examples and tutorials how to use the Coding Unicorn Shield. We will also link to other projects. Demo and Documentation

With this project we are showing you the current status of the Python Libary for the Raspberry Pi and how you can create your own Demo. You can find the example code here and the documentation and the tutorial here.

Personal Email Notifications

With this project you will your own personal email notification unicorn. Check with one lock if you have unread emails or use the do not disturb mode. You can find the example code here and the tutorial here

Hashtag Watcher

With this project you can make your Unicorn Shield blink everytime a certain hashtag is used on Twitter. You can find the example code here and a tutorial here.

The photobooth

This is a small example what you can do with the Unicorn Shield and the Raspberry Pi Camera Module. We have the example code and a short tutorial here.

People on the ISS

Do you every whonder how many people are in space? With the Coding Unicorn Shield and the Raspberry Pi you can easily build a display for that. We have the example code and a short tutorial here.
